NC woman charged in drunken driving crash

RALEIGH, N.C. -- Police have charged a North Carolina woman with drunken driving and felony death by vehicle following a car crash that left one person dead.

Raleigh police said a car driven by 27-year-old Manuela Mantanona Gomez of Raleigh slammed into the back of another car stopped at a red light killing 24-year-old John Sullivan of Charlotte on Saturday. Sullivan was trapped in the back seat of the car that was hit.

Police say Gomez was injured and taken to WakeMed. A spokesman said Sunday that Gomez remained at the hospital and was in good condition.

Two other people in the car with Sullivan were hurt in the wreck, but their injuries were not thought to be life-threatening.
